Words fail me when I see this.
This young man was one of around 10 people who I saw posing on a white spot in the middle of 8 lanes of traffic going at full speed around the Arc de Triomphe.
Just so he could get a selfie in front of the monument.
Traffic was speeding past this spot in both directions, a matter of feet away from him.
I don’t know if the spot and narrow lane is meant to be some kind of pedestrian area. But as with the painted strips that are pathetic excuses for a proper bike lane, it simply isn’t enough.
A painted line offers no protection from eight lanes of traffic..
Paris is making progress in tackling the dominance of the car, under its energetic mayor Anne Hidalgo. She recently ordered that the Champs Elysees should be traffic-free for one day a month. It was a resounding success.
But there is still a long way to go, if Paris is serious about tackling air quality and being a properly liveable city.
In the meantime, it should get rid of this stupid spot – an invitation to put yourself in harm’s way, which too many people find it hard to resist.
